The breakdown:
Firstly, the diffusion and refraction map are made from combining the album cover for No Pressure, some shape elements made, and the text all in Photoshop seen in the picture under.
Here in the picture under is the refraction map, the way it works is the white parts are being refracted when put in the refraction node, the black parts are not. The refraction map is inversely proportional to the diffusion map.
Then I applied the maps I made on 2 materials on C4D, the first is for the diffusion and refraction combined as seen on the 2 pictures under, then applied on a thin plane. With caustics and color dispersion and the refraction IOR at 1.7; physically accurate to real life glass for more light accuracy and realism seen on the second and third picture.

Under the thin layer, I put a cuboid-like shape for thickness for the panel, to it I applied the clear glass material with no diffusion. Also a thinned and stretched out torus in the back for light and aesthetics.
Added a vibrate tag to the camera object and set frequency on 0.5 for slight subtle movement
Along with the vibrate tag I added additional movement by placing keyframes of the plane rotating to the left to the z axis on frame ~188 and to the right on 361And finally it was rendered at 30 fps at a res of 3840x2160 over 53 hours, here is the viewport.
